How do you assemble a bolt action pen kit?
How do you assemble a bolt action pen kit?
Press the front end into either end of the barrel. Press the back end assembly into the opposite end of the barrel. Unscrew the tip and insert the refill into the opening at the front end. Insert the spring over the refill and replace the tip.

How do you assemble a bullet pen?
Unscrew the tip off of the front end of the cartridge assembly. Insert the refill spring over the refill end. Insert the refill, black end in first into the opening at the tip, screw the tip back on. Drop the plunger spring into the opening at the clip end, follow with the plunger, screw in.
At what rpm do you turn a pen?
between 3,000 and 3,500 rpm
We recommend a lathe speed of between 3,000 and 3,500 rpm. This allows the turner to be more aggressive and speeds up the process of both turning and finishing. Start sanding with 120 grit or finer if the surface left by the tool is sufficiently smooth.

Is CA finish durable?
A CA finish is made by building up many really thin layers of super glue on your pen, then polishing them to a high-gloss. It is the most durable finish I’ve found and can be used on virtually all woods, stabilized woods, and even acrylics.

What is the best speed for turning wood?
The wood lathe speed rule of thumb is – do not to exceed 1,000 RPMs. One thousand RPMs seems to be a magical point at which bowl blanks either go up or down if they come off the lathe. If the speed is under 1,000 RPMs, then a dislodged bowl blank is supposed to fall to the floor.
What speed should wood be turned at?
A good rule of thumb is, “the wider the stock, the lower the speed.” In other words, a relatively narrow piece of stock (about 2-1/2″ in thickness or thinner) can be turned at about 1500-2000 RPM (longer pieces should be cut at the lower end of the range), while thicker pieces should be turned at about half that speed.
